Perikatan unaware of ‘friendly contest’


Working as one: (From left) Datuk Yong Teck Lee, Hajiji and Datuk Dr Jeffrey Kitingan uniting with their parties to contest ­ in the upcoming Sabah state ­election.

KOTA KINABALU: Sabah Perikatan Nasional is not aware of its allies fielding candidates in the three seats it is contesting.

Sabah Parti Pribumi Bersatu Malaysia chief Datuk Seri Hajiji Mohd Noor said this when he announced that Perikatan would be contesting a total of 29 seats in the state election.
